Abstract

An electric system is disclosed. The electric system comprises a battery subassembly, a current limiter, a non-current-limiting path in parallel with the current limiter, a battery management system (BMS) adapted for causing the battery assembly to energize the electric system using the current limiter upon a start of a precharge phase, and an electric vehicle module (EVM) communicatively coupled to the BMS. The EVM is adapted for causing the battery assembly to energize the electric system using the non-current-limiting path following a completion of the precharge phase. The electric system may be integrated in an electric vehicle. A method for energizing an electric system is also disclosed.

Claims (8)

1. An electric system comprising:

a first battery module comprising at least one first battery cell, a first battery management system (BMS) and a first BMS switching power supply, the at least one first battery cell and the first BMS switching power supply being disconnected when the first BMS is in an inactive state, the at least one first battery cell and the first BMS switching power supply being connected when the first BMS is in a powered state;

a second battery module electrically connectable to the first battery module, the second battery module comprising at least one second battery cell, a second BMS and a second BMS switching power supply, the at least one second battery cell and the second BMS switching power supply being disconnected when the second BMS is in an inactive state, the at least one second battery cell and the second BMS switching power supply being connected when the second BMS is in a powered state; and

a user-controlled switch adapted for causing a connection of the at least one first battery cell to the first BMS switching power supply for energizing the first BMS and for changing the first BMS from the inactive state to the powered state;

the first BMS being adapted for causing a connection of the at least one second battery cell to the second BMS switching power supply for energizing the second BMS and for changing the second BMS from the inactive state to the powered state when the first BMS is in the powered state;

the first BMS being further adapted for closing a current-limiting path placed in series between the first and second battery modules to start a precharge phase of the electric system once a communication between the first BMS and the second BMS is established.

2. The electric system of claim 1 , wherein the first BMS is further adapted for performing initial verifications before closing the current-limiting path.

3. The electric system of claim 2 , wherein the initial verifications comprise a confirmation of the communication between the first BMS and the second BMS.
